Shift4 Payments, Inc. provides integrated payments and commerce technology for businesses across in-store, online, mobile and venue-based channels. Company news commonly covers quarterly financial results, payment-processing partnerships, sports and entertainment venue deployments, restaurant technology integrations, and updates to products such as SkyTab and platforms such as The Giving Block.
Recurring developments also include leadership changes, international commercial organization updates, preferred-stock dividends, and customer wins in restaurants, hospitality, stadiums, nonprofits and other verticals. Shift4 describes its platform as handling transaction processing, merchant acquiring, omni-channel gateway capabilities, eCommerce tools and reporting services for businesses in the United States and internationally.

Shift4 (NYSE: FOUR) has partnered with Mashgin, integrating payment processing with AI-driven self-checkout technology. This integration enables retailers to minimize checkout lines using Mashgin kiosks, already present in over 2,300 U.S. locations, including stadiums and airports. The kiosks utilize multiple cameras for 99.9% item recognition accuracy, allowing transactions up to 400% faster than traditional cashiers, and have documented sales increases of 25%-400% in stadiums. Shift4's broad payment ecosystem supports over 200,000 merchant locations globally, simplifying operations and costs for diverse businesses.

Shift4 (NYSE: FOUR) has partnered with Real Salt Lake to enhance the gameday experience at America First Field and Zions Bank Stadium. This collaboration introduces Shift4's comprehensive payment solution, enabling fans to conduct transactions using a single account and offering personalized experiences. The integration extends to ticketing through SeatGeek. Real Salt Lake President John Kimball expressed confidence in Shift4's ability to streamline payment processes, enhancing convenience for fans. Shift4's solution aims to reduce payment complexities, thereby improving overall stadium operations.
Shift4 (NYSE: FOUR) has successfully processed transactions in Europe through its SkyTab POS and VenueNext mobile solutions. This achievement marks a significant milestone in expanding its services internationally. CEO Jared Isaacman emphasized the importance of these cross-border transactions as they aim to create a global unified payments experience. The company plans to launch these technologies in Europe next year, offering a complete suite of payment solutions.

Shift4 has partnered with the Chickasaw Nation to process payments across its 23 casinos and additional tribal-owned locations, including WinStar World Casino and Resort, the world's largest casino. This collaboration aims to enhance payment processing and improve customer experience at these venues. Shift4 will provide commerce-enabling hardware and work with Everi for cashless operations. This agreement significantly expands Shift4's customer base, reinforcing its position as a leader in integrated payments.
Shift4 (NYSE: FOUR) has launched a new online payments platform aimed at supporting eCommerce businesses of all sizes. This platform allows for customizable checkout forms, supporting over 160 currencies and 24 languages. Key features include smart anti-fraud tools, support for various payment scenarios like subscriptions and one-time payments, and a robust API for developers. CTO Mike Russo highlighted its security and flexibility, positioning it as a competitive solution for complex merchants globally.
